Information processing device
The information processing device addresses the need for screen switching by integrating dynamic and static product selection buttons on the same screen, improving operator efficiency and reducing operational burden.

[Technical Field]
[0001] An embodiment of the present invention relates to an information processing device. [Background technology]
[0002] BACKGROUND ART Conventionally, an information processing device (touch panel type cash register device) described in Patent Document 1 below, for example, is known.
[0003] This conventional information processing device is installed and used in, for example, a dry cleaner's, and includes a touch panel unit that is a display unit that displays information, and a control unit that controls the touch panel unit.
[0004] One product input screen displayed by the touch panel displays horizontally elongated rectangular frequently ordered product selection buttons (for example, product name keys of the top five most frequently ordered products) that change for each customer based on past order history information. Also, another product input screen different from the one product input screen displays roughly square regular product selection buttons that do not change for each customer regardless of past order history information. [Prior art documents] [Patent documents]
[0005] [Patent Document 1] Japanese Patent Application Laid-Open No. 2005-222470 Summary of the Invention [Problem to be solved by the invention]
[0006] However, in conventional information processing devices, the screen displaying the frequently-used product selection button and the screen displaying the regular product selection button are separate screens, so the dry cleaner's staff (operators) may have to go to the trouble of switching screens, which is time-consuming.
[0007] Therefore, one of the objects of the embodiment of the present invention is to provide an information processing device that can reduce the burden on the operator. [Means for solving the problem]
[0008] An information processing device according to an embodiment of the present invention comprises a display unit that displays information and a control unit that controls the display unit, and the display unit simultaneously displays a frequently-used product selection button that changes for each customer based on past order history information relating to past cleaning orders, and a regular product selection button that does not change for each customer regardless of the past order history information. [0011] An embodiment of the present invention will be described with reference to FIGS.
[0012] In FIG. 1, reference numeral 1 denotes a POS terminal which is an information processing device. This POS terminal 1 is installed in, for example, a member-only dry cleaning store, and is operated (used) by a clerk (operator) of the dry cleaning store.
[0013] The POS terminal 1 includes, for example, a control unit (information processing unit) 2, a memory unit (information memory unit) 3 that stores various types of information, a touch panel unit (input unit and display unit) 4 that is a display unit that also serves as an input unit that a store clerk touches with their fingertips to input information, a printing unit 5 that prints out various printed materials (such as slips), and a reading unit 6 that reads information such as barcodes.
[0014] The control unit 2 controls at least the touch panel unit 4 and the printing unit 5 as appropriate based on various information stored (registered) in the storage unit 3.
[0015] Therefore, the touch panel unit 4, which is a display unit that displays various information (including, for example, customer information, product information, etc.) regarding the items to be cleaned (received items) that are accepted as products upon receiving cleaning orders from customers, displays, under the control of the control unit 2, a set number (for example, multiple) of frequently used product selection buttons 11 that change for each customer based on, for example, past order history information (information on past purchased products) regarding past cleaning orders by the customer (member customer), and a fixed number of regular product selection buttons (regular selection buttons for product selection that are preset by each dry cleaning store) 12 that do not change for each customer regardless of the past order history information, all in the same display format and the same size on the same screen (see Figure 5, etc.).
[0016] That is, this POS terminal 1 has a function for registering button layout (key layout), and is configured so that the frequently appearing product selection button 11 can be placed in a part of the display position of the regular product selection button 11.
[0017] The product selection buttons (operation buttons) 11, 12, which are the operation targets that can be touched by the clerk with the fingertips, are product name buttons (product name keys) for selecting the product to be cleaned (input) when accepting a cleaning order from a customer. Each button 11, 12 has at least characters (e.g., "men's jacket," "skirt," etc.) indicating the product name (name of the cleaning product) on its surface, but it may also have the product name and price on its surface.
[0018] The past order history information includes, for example, the names of products that a member customer has ordered for cleaning (including product purchases) in the past, and the frequency (weight value) based on the number of times that order was made. The control unit 2 has a function of information updating means (see Japanese Patent No. 3856794) that periodically multiplies the frequency of all products by a number greater than 0 and less than 1 (for example, 0.3) so that the frequency of cleaning products that have only been frequently appearing in the past decreases and the frequency of recently frequently appearing products increases. Note that while it is preferable for the control unit 2 to have this function, it may, for example, not have this function.

[0028] Next, the operation of the POS terminal 1 will be described.
[0029] When a customer comes to a dry cleaning store with items to be cleaned and the store clerk identifies the customer by inputting a membership number, telephone number, etc., a product input screen such as that shown in Figure 4 (for example, a screen for customer "Light Taro" and the number of buttons displayed is "25"), a product input screen such as that shown in Figure 5 (for example, a screen for customer "Light Taro" and the number of buttons displayed is "9"), or a product input screen such as that shown in Figure 6 (for example, a screen for customer "Light Hanako" and the number of buttons displayed is "25") will be displayed.
[0030] Each product input screen has a slightly horizontally elongated rectangular button display area (button display portion) 26 for displaying a frequent product selection button 11 and a regular product selection button 12, and as shown in the figure, multiple product selection buttons 11, 12 (for example, "25" or "9") arranged in a matrix are simultaneously displayed within this button display area 26.
[0031] At this time, for example, in at least the top first column of the button display area 26 (the first column that the store clerk looks at first), multiple frequently ordered product selection buttons (group of frequently ordered product selection buttons) 11 determined based on the past order history information of each customer are displayed.
[0032] Then, when the store clerk touches the buttons 11 and 12 corresponding to the cleaning items (products) ordered by the customer, the cleaning items related to the cleaning order are selected and input (product registration).
[0033] As shown in the figure, it is preferable that the frequently appearing product selection button 11 is located in at least the top row within the button display area 26, but the position of the frequently appearing product selection button 11 displayed in the button display area 26 can be arbitrarily selected (pre-set) from multiple positions in a matrix within the button display area 26, so it is not limited to the example shown in the figure and other arrangements are also possible.
[0034] Furthermore, in the illustrated example, the frequently appearing product selection button 11 and the regular product selection button 12 located within the button display area 26 are displayed in exactly the same display format, including color and shape, but this is not limited to this, and for example, at least one of the color of the characters indicating the product name and the button color (only the color of the characters, only the button color, or both colors) may be displayed differently from each other.
[0035] That is, for example, on the screen shown in FIG. 4, the text of the five frequently appearing product selection buttons 11 in the first column may be one color (e.g., red), while the text of the remaining regular product selection buttons 12 in the second column and thereafter may be another color (e.g., black) different from the one color; or, the button color of the five frequently appearing product selection buttons 11 in the first column may be one color (e.g., red), while the button color of the remaining regular product selection buttons 12 in the second column and thereafter may be another color (e.g., blue) different from the one color; or, further, both the text color and the button color may be different.
[0036] FIG. 7 is a flowchart showing the flow of button display processing by the control unit 2 of the POS terminal 1.
[0037] 7, the control unit 2 refers to the display setting of the target button (step 1), determines whether the frequently appearing product display setting (setting of the frequently appearing product selection button) is set (step 2), and if the answer is "NO", refers to the set product (step 3) and displays the referred product (step 4). On the other hand, if the answer is "YES" in step 2, refers to the product in the designated order for the current customer (the customer currently being accepted) (step 5), and displays the referred product (step 4).
[0038] Furthermore, according to the above-mentioned POS terminal 1, the touch panel unit 4 simultaneously displays, on a single product input screen, a frequently-used product selection button 11 that changes for each customer based on past order history information relating to the customer's past cleaning orders, and a regular product selection button 12 that remains the same for each customer regardless of the past order history information, thereby eliminating the need for screen switching operations that were necessary in conventional devices, thereby reducing the burden on the cleaning store staff (operators).
[0039] Furthermore, the touch panel unit 4 of the POS terminal 1 simultaneously displays a plurality of frequent product selection buttons 11 and regular product selection buttons 12 in a button display area 26 on one product input screen so that the plurality of frequent product selection buttons 11 and regular product selection buttons 12 are arranged in a matrix. When the number of displayed buttons is set to a single number (for example, 25) based on the operation of the display number setting button 17, the single number (for example, 25) of frequent product selection buttons 11 and regular product selection buttons 12, all of which have the same shape (for example, substantially square), are simultaneously displayed in the button display area 26 as regular buttons of the same size, and when the number of displayed buttons is set to a single number (for example, 25) based on the operation of the display number setting button 17, the frequent product selection buttons 11 and regular product selection buttons 12 are simultaneously displayed in the button display area 26 as regular buttons of the same size. When another number (for example, 9) less than one number (for example, 25) is set based on the operation of button 28, the other number (for example, 9) of frequent product selection buttons 11 and regular product selection buttons 12, all of which have the same shape (for example, roughly square), are simultaneously displayed in button display area 26 as enlarged buttons of the same size, but at a size larger than the one size.Since both buttons 11, 12 are displayed at the same size on the same screen, store clerks can operate the buttons smoothly and without feeling uncomfortable, and even store clerks who have difficulty seeing small buttons can easily see them by changing them to enlarged buttons, thereby further reducing the burden on store clerks (operators) at dry cleaners.
[0040] Furthermore, the touch panel unit 4 of the POS terminal 1 displays the frequently-available product selection button 11 in at least the top row of the button display area 26, making it easier for store clerks to find the frequently-available product selection button 11 and improving operability.
